我想知道共享主机帐户中我的网站有多少个活动连接。
托管服务提供商正在使用cPanel,我可以通过ssh访问它。
问题是如果我运行命令:
netstat -tuna | wc -l
它会返回一个疯狂的2555连接数,但是当我进入谷歌分析并访问实时部分时,只有15-20个用户处于活动状态。
我的问题是那些2555连接到我的网站,或整个服务器,无论我用来运行命令的用户。 (我没有root访问权限。)
答案 0 :(得分:2)
您的netstat命令显示您的服务器的所有连接不仅仅是Apache连接,如果您只想检查Apache连接。您必须使用以下命令。
netstat -anp |grep 80 |wc -l
但是使用上面的命令,您将获得Apache连接的总数。您的网站托管在共享服务器上,因此您无法检查您的网站连接。
要检查我们的站点连接,您必须为您的站点分配专用IP,并使用上述命令中的IP来检查您的站点Apache连接
netstat -anp |grep 80 |grep 1.1.1.1 | wc -l
谢谢